合成聚合物多元醇用新型引发剂的研究  被引量:2

Study on novel initiator for polymer polyol synthesis

摘  要:为解决聚合物多元醇(POP)生产中常用引发剂偶氮二异丁腈(AIBN)使用时会产生剧毒物并在后期脱单时会堵塞管道等问题,用过氧化–2–乙基己酸叔戊酯(TAPH)替代AIBN作引发剂;使用溶剂将TAPH配制成稀释液进行试验,解决TAPH运输及存储问题;并向稀释液中引入高分解温度过氧化物配制成复配液,用不同浓度的复配液进行工业性试验,得出了工业生产条件下TAPH的最佳用量。In order to solve the problems occurred in polymer polyol(POP) production using the common azobisisobutyronitrile(AIBN) as initiator producing highly toxic substances and blocking pipelines during the later stage for monomer removal,the tert-amy1 peroxy-2-ethylhexanoate(TAPH) was used as initiator for replacing AIBN.The transportation and storage problems of TAPH were solved by preparing the diluted solution of TAPH with solvent for testing.Introducing the peroxide with high decomposition temperature into the diluted solution to prepare the built solution,the industrial tests were carried out by using the built solutions of different concentrations,and the optimal used amount of TAPH under industrial production conditions was given out.
